Acclaimed MUTTS Cartoonist Patrick McDonnell Launches 'Adopt Love' Campaign To Raise Awareness for Pet Adoption and Fostering

MUTTS Joins Forces With Animal Care Centers of NYC, Muddy Paws Rescue, and Isabel Klee for a Month-Long Campaign this August

Between his compassionate, heartfelt MUTTS comic strips, his 18 years as a member of the Board of Directors of the Humane Society of the United States, and his work on the board for the Fund for Animals, renowned cartoonist Patick McDonnell has spent his life helping and celebrating animals in need. To further this great effort, MUTTS is joining forces with Animal Care Centers of NYC, Muddy Paws Rescue, and Isabel Klee (@SimonSits) for the Adopt Love Campaign to raise awareness for pet adoption and fostering. Timed to coincide with Clear the Shelters Month, the Adopt Love campaign will feature new art from McDonnell, a giving campaign, and more on MUTTS.com throughout August. 

“This August, I’m partnering with Animal Care Centers of New York, Muddy Paws Rescue, and Isabel Klee to help you find your new best friend at a local animal shelter,” says McDonnell. “It’s ‘Clear the Shelters’ month, the perfect time to adopt or foster a pet. Giving an animal a loving home is a pure act of kindness. A win-win for everyone. Let’s make this a true Summer of Love!”

The Adopt Love campaign will feature a giving campaign benefitting ACC’s STAR Fund, which provides life-saving medical and surgical care to dogs, cats, and rabbits; spotlights on adoptable animals at ACC; original content and storytelling to showcase the behind-the-scenes work of animal rescuers and the lifesaving impact of fostering and adopting; and new comic art and merchandise from Patrick McDonnell.

MUTTS’ Adopt Love campaign will be live from Friday, August 4 through Sunday, August 31.
